Air fryer temperature and timing
The temperature and timing for cooking smokies in an air fryer will depend on the type of smokies you are cooking and whether you are cooking them in a sauce or directly on the grate.
If you are cooking them in a sauce, you should set your air fryer to 360-380 degrees Fahrenheit and cook for 15 minutes, stirring halfway through. If you are cooking them directly on the grate, set your air fryer to 380 degrees Fahrenheit and cook for 8 minutes.
If you are cooking bacon-wrapped smokies, set your air fryer to 390 degrees Fahrenheit and cook for 5 minutes. Flip the smokies and continue cooking for another 2-3 minutes, or until the bacon is as crispy as you like.
If you are cooking cocktail sausages or lil' smokies, set your air fryer to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and cook for 5-10 minutes, tossing halfway through. If you want to add BBQ sauce and brown sugar, cook for an additional 2-3 minutes.
It is important to note that cooking times may vary depending on the brand and model of your air fryer, so you may need to adjust the timing accordingly.

Pre-cooked vs fresh smokies
Smokies, or smoked sausages, can be cooked in an air fryer. The process is straightforward and quick, and the results are plump and crispy.
When cooking pre-cooked smoked sausages in an air fryer, the process is faster and simpler. Pre-cooked sausages only need to be heated, so they require less time in the air fryer, typically around 5-6 minutes. There is also no need to pierce the sausages, as they are already cooked. This convenience makes pre-cooked sausages a great option for quick meals or appetizers.
On the other hand, cooking fresh, uncooked smoked sausages in an air fryer requires slightly more preparation and cooking time. It is recommended to poke holes in the casings of fresh sausages to allow the fat to escape easily. The cooking time for fresh sausages in an air fryer is generally around 8-12 minutes, depending on the thickness of the sausages.
Both pre-cooked and fresh smokies can be sliced before cooking, but keeping the links intact helps retain moisture and flavour.
In terms of taste and texture, pre-cooked sausages are typically more smoky in flavour and have a firmer texture due to the pre-cooking process. Fresh sausages, when cooked properly, can have a juicier texture and a more delicate flavour.
Ultimately, the choice between pre-cooked and fresh smokies depends on personal preference, time constraints, and desired flavour and texture. Both options can be successfully cooked in an air fryer, resulting in a convenient, tasty meal or snack.

Storing leftovers
Smokies, or sausages, can be cooked in an air fryer. They are a quick and easy meal to make, taking less than 15 minutes to cook.
Leftover smokies can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. To extend the shelf life of the cooked smokies, you can freeze them. They will last for up to 2 months in the freezer.
When storing leftovers, it is important to let the smokies cool down to room temperature before placing them in the container and into the refrigerator. This prevents bacteria from growing and ensures the smokies stay fresh for longer.
If you are storing the smokies in the freezer, it is best to wrap them tightly in plastic wrap, aluminium foil, or place them in a freezer bag. You can also coat the smokies in a layer of oil before freezing to prevent them from drying out.
To reheat the smokies, you can either thaw them in the refrigerator overnight and then reheat them in the air fryer for a few minutes, or you can place them directly into the air fryer from frozen and cook until heated through.
